Lithium batteries, which include lithium-ion and lithium-polymer batteries, are rechargeable power sources widely used in modern technology. They are favored for their high energy density, lightweight nature, and long cycle life compared to traditional batteries. However, these batteries also present unique hazards, particularly when it comes to shipping.
The shipping of lithium batteries is subject to varying restrictions due to the risks they pose. Lithium batteries can undergo thermal runaway—a chain reaction that can lead to overheating, fire, or even explosions if not correctly handled. Additionally, if damaged or improperly packaged, these batteries can leak harmful chemicals.
